You can change the address registered with your NRI Zerodha account only through offline process, unlike resident individual accounts that you can change online. You need to submit documents and pay ₹25 + 18% GST. The address update takes up to 72 working hours.
Important requirements
You are considered a Non-Resident Indian (NRI) if you are a citizen of India or Person of Indian Origin (PIO) who resides outside India for more than 182 days. If you hold a resident individual account after becoming an NRI, you must convert it to an NRI-NRO account.
- ITD status: NRIs and PIOs must ensure that their residential status is marked as Non-resident on the ITD website before opening an account.

Document notarisation:
If your KYC status is updated as Non-resident with the latest address, you only need self-attested copies. If not updated as a Non-resident with the latest address, you must
notarise documents
through the Indian embassy, authorised officials of overseas branches of scheduled commercial banks registered in India, public notaries, court magistrates, judges, or the Indian embassy/consulate general in your country. The attesting authority should affix a
Verified with original
stamp, name, designation, authority or employee code, signature and date.
